The Far Flung Trio on tour January/February 2019

The Far Flung Trio are Katherine Hunka (violin), Dermot Dunne (accordion) and Malachy Robinson (bass).

Getting 2019 off to a flying start, the Far Flung Trio are on tour in January-February with an irresistible musical programme that is virtuosic, eccentric and charming in their signature style. The seductive melodies of Bizet’s Carmen and Rossini’s mischievous Barber of Seville overture ... jazzy tunes by Gershwin and an original work by Irish jazz giant Ronan Guilfoyle ... and lots more, all tailored by the Trio and delivered with panache and delight. Starting on 12th January, the Trio will visit The Whale Greystones, St.John’s Theatre Listowel, Glór Ennis, The Belltable Limerick, Linenhall Arts Centre Castlebar, All Saints’ Church Mullingar, Dunamaise Arts Centre Portlaoise, City Hall Waterford and finishing in Roscommon Arts Centre on 5th February.

In Greystones, Ennis, Limerick, Portlaoise and Waterford the Trio will give Family Concert performances based on Prokofiev’s Peter and the Wolf of approx. 1 hour. Malachy Robinson of the Trio says: “This is a piece that appealed to us primarily because of the storytelling element - the narration will be undertaken by the trio while playing. It is also a piece full of enchanting melodies and rich textures that we have enjoyed arranging to suit our instruments. Prokofiev’s colourful orchestration has been fascinating to engage with, stimulating our imagination as we hope it will the audience’s.”
